80 gallons freshwater fish tank (mostly fish and non-living decorations) - The large cichlid population in the tank enjoy the natural rock cave environment. If you look closely to the bottom left you will see a breeding pair or cichlids. Adding rock to my tank has cut down on the agression of the fish and has also given all of them a territory to call there own.
